Have a look at the apn settings:

Go to Settings → System → Mobile Network → Mobile Data → tap and hold on the connection name → edit.

If your home network is o2 — Try changing the apn settings to "internet" as proposed in this answer. This worked for me (and some other folks, too).

If your home network is e-plus/base — Have a look at the apn settings and check if they are the same as the [manual config page of e-plus/base say. (Should both be the same, though.)
